10 Frequently Asked Quesions Regarding the Cisco Certification

Filed under Computers

1. What's Cisco certification? This is when one receives a certificate attesting to the proficiency of an individual in Cisco related products given by Cisco. In its Career Certification Program, Cisco request that there should be certified engineer in all Cisco agents, so as to provide better service to clients as well as build a certification system for network engineers who are familiar to Cisco product.

2. Why go for Cisco certification? To be an international talent, an international certification is no doubt the best gateway to achieving international relevance in the IT field. While among all certifications in market, Cisco certification which was released by the well-known network enterprise Cisco enjoys wild acceptance and great reputation.

What are the benefits of certification? a) Candidates who gains Cisco certification usually enjoys a favorable salary; and b) a certified person who can enjoy credit exemptions for associate professions

4. Can one without college education get Cisco certification? Yes, one can, in fact there are a huge number of candidates who didn't have computer major background. Only if you own courage and capability in learning something new, you can pursue Cisco certification and there is great opportunity for you to gain certification.

How much does Cisco Certified Internetwork Expert(CCIE) certification cost? Two exams, written exam and lab exam, are required for CCIE certification. The written exam costs $350 USD/ZAR2800 while the beta exams allow $50 USD/ZAR400 discount. The lab exam costs $1400 USD/ZAR11,600. If candidates can't pass both the exam at their first try, it may cost more.

Can One take Cisco Certified Network Professional exam directly? No, one can not. A valid CCNA certification can act as the prerequisite of CCNP exam.

10. What can one do after gaining Cisco Certified Network Associate (CCNA) certification? As we all know, CCNA certification is an associate level certification which validate the fundamental skills and knowledge of candidates'. CCNA certification enables candidate to pursue other higher level certifications, which means CCNA is just a springboard for candidate. After gaining CCNA certification, candidates can consider about pursuing other higher level certifications in Cisco certification system

Warding Off Viruses

Filed under Computers

Protecting your computer from viruses is getting more and |more difficult each day. While it may sound a little paranoid, it is true that you cannot let your defense drop for one second. Even commercial giant Microsoft has found its own systems compromised on more than one occasion.

Do you remember the 'good old days', before the arrival of the Internet and downloadable programs? Life was simple then in terms of computer viruses. The primary way to catch a virus then was via floppy disks. By today's standards, it used to take quite a while before a virus was able to infect a computer and slow down the system. The antivirus software of that time was usually able to identify and eliminate viruses before they caused too much harm. Additionally, computer users were fairly knowledgeable about how to defend themselves by scanning all floppy disks before using them.

The Internet changed all that. The Internet provided a medium by which viruses could travel from host to host with blinding speed. A computer user had to start to think about email, email attachments, peer-to-peer file sharing, instant messaging, and software downloads as virus entry points. Modern viruses can attack through multiple entry points, propagate without human intervention, and take full advantage of vulnerabilities within a system or program. With technology advancing everyday, and the union of computers with other mobile devices, the potential for new types of threats also increases.

Fortunately, the development of antivirus software has kept pace with the virus threats. Antivirus software is indispensable to a computer's ability to ward off viruses and other malicious programs. These software products are designed to guard against the ability of a virus to enter a computer through email, web browsers, file servers and desktops. Moreover, these programs offer a control feature that handles deployment, configuration and updating. A computer user should remain diligent and follow a couple of simple steps to guard against the threat of a virus:

You should appraise your current computer security system. With the danger of a new generation of viruses being able to attack in a multitude of ways, the approach of having just one sort of antivirus software has become outdated. You have to be certain that you have protected all aspects of your computer system from the desktop to the network, and from the gateway to the server. Think about a more comprehensive security system which encompasses several features including antivirus, firewall, content filtering, and intrusion detection. This type of system will make it more difficult for the virus to infiltrate your system.

You should install antivirus software created by a well-known, reputable company, because new viruses come out daily, so it is vital that you update your antivirus software daily. Become familiar with your software's real-time scan feature and configure it to start automatically each time you start up your computer. This will protect your system by automatically checking your computer each time it is powered up.

Set your antivirus software to scan all new programs or files no matter from where they originate from and exercise caution when opening binary, Word, or Excel documents of unknown origin especially if they were received during an online chat or as an attachment to an email.

Make sure you perform regular backups in case your system is corrupted. It may be the only way to retrieve your data if you computer becomes infected.

There are numerous applications available to consumers, so with a little research, you should be able to pick the program that is right for you. Many programs provide a trial version which allows you to download the program and test its capabilities. However, be aware that some anti-virus programs can be difficult to uninstall, so as a precaution make sure you set up a System Restore point and take back-ups before installing it.
